Fix uninitialized character pointer, and functions that return
undefined values. These issues were caught by running clang using LLVM=1
option; and are as follows:
--
ovpn-cli.c:1587:6: warning: variable 'ret' is used uninitialized whenever 'if' condition is true [-Wsometimes-uninitialized]
1587 | if (!sock) {
| ^~~~~
ovpn-cli.c:1635:9: note: uninitialized use occurs here
1635 | return ret;
| ^~~
ovpn-cli.c:1587:2: note: remove the 'if' if its condition is always false
1587 | if (!sock) {
| ^~~~~~~~~~~~
1588 | fprintf(stderr, "cannot allocate netlink socket\n");
| 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
1589 | goto err_free;
| 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
1590 | }
| ~
ovpn-cli.c:1584:15: note: initialize the variable 'ret' to silence this warning
1584 | int mcid, ret;
| ^
| = 0
ovpn-cli.c:2107:7: warning: variable 'ret' is used uninitialized whenever switch case is taken [-Wsometimes-uninitialized]
2107 | case CMD_INVALID:
| ^~~~~~~~~~~
ovpn-cli.c:2111:9: note: uninitialized use occurs here
2111 | return ret;
| ^~~
ovpn-cli.c:1939:12: note: initialize the variable 'ret' to silence this warning
1939 | int n, ret;
| ^
|
--
so_txtime.c:210:3: warning: variable 'reason' is used uninitialized whenever switch default is taken [-Wsometimes-uninitialized]
210 | default:
| ^~~~~~~
so_txtime.c:219:27: note: uninitialized use occurs here
219 | data[ret - 1], tstamp, reason);
| ^~~~~~
so_txtime.c:177:21: note: initialize the variable 'reason' to silence this warning
177 | const char *reason;
| ^
|
--
Fixes: 959bc330a439 ("testing/selftests: add test tool and scripts for ovpn module")
ovpn module")
Fixes: ca8826095e4d4 ("selftests/net: report etf errors correctly")
Signed-off-by: Sidharth Seela <sidharthseela@gmail.com>
v2:
- Use subsystem name "net".
- Add fixes tags.
- Remove txtimestamp fix as default case calls error.
- Assign constant error string instead of NULL.

My previous response accidentally left a state comment. The main
feedback still held:
This default case calls error() and exits the program, so this cannot
happen.

Alright, I thought error() is like perror(). After checking man pages, the
status being non-zero leads to exit(). So yes, it makes sense now, the
switch case, either loads up a value in the 'reason' or exits().
